Tofu Sticky Fingers with Blue Cheese Sauce [Vegan]
These sticky tofu fingers are the ultimate game-day treat. The tofu crispy tofu is marinated well before being tossed in a tangy, sweet sauce and served with a decadent, chunky blue 'cheese' sauce to dip in.

How to Prepare Tofu Sticky Fingers With Blue Cheese Sauce [Vegan]
- Preheat the oven to 425°F.
- Cut pressed tofu into strips about an inch wide and 1/2-inch thick. Place into a sealable plastic bag and toss in the 2 tablespoons of flour.
- Place the almond milk and apple cider vinegar in a bowl and stir. Let sit for a minute to thicken. Place the Panko in another bowl.
- Dip each piece of tofu into the almond milk and then coat with the Panko.
- Place them onto a baking sheet sprayed with nonstick spray. Repeat with each piece of tofu.
- Line them up next to each other on the pan. Spray each piece of tofu with more nonstick spray.
- Bake them at 425°F for 15-20 minutes until they're brown and crispy.
- While the tofu is baking, make the sauce. Add all the sauce ingredients to a small saucepan.
- Heat them on medium-high, whisking them until the sugar has dissolved.
- Turn the stove on low and cook the for a minute or so until it thickens a bit. Turn off the heat and let it sit until the tofu is done.
- Make the blue cheese by whisking all the ingredients together except the tofu.
- Make sure the water is all pressed out of the tofu, then crumble really well so it looks like cheese crumbles, and stir it into the dip. Set this aside.
- When the tofu is ready, toss it in the sauce and serve it immediately with blue cheese dip.
